Missed something setting up second nic
I took my 3com 3c905 nic out when I installed Woody. Tried it in another
box. I'm presently trying to get it reinstalled in my Woody install but
can't get it to register in the network. First off this is going in
alongside a KTI ne2k-pci compat nic. The kti nic is working fine in
eth0. And I'm using linuxconf to setup the nics. But when I set the 3com
nic up it won't go. I have the box connected to a win95 machine through
Samba and it connects fine through the kti nic on eth0 but the 3com
won't register in eth1 or eth0. Also my Woody machine is a dual boot
with my old Mandrake 8.2 install (on hda2) Now in Mandy I run linuxconf
and setup the kti nic in eth0 and the 3com in eth1 and it works fine. I
can connect to both eth0 or eth1 when I have the address set in the
WIn95 box, so I know the card works. And in Woody, when I bring up the
KDE control panel and bring up the pci information it lists the 3com nic
as well as my kti nic and my sb16 pci and my agp ATI Rage II. So it is
there. So what Am I missing? When I type route -n it only lists the kti
nic route. It is also listed by lspci. So I know it's there. So it must
be a configuration issue. But for the life of me I can't think what I'm
missing. I know it works fine in Mandy and I'm sure I had this setup
once upon a time when I first setup Woody, but can't remember what was
different. I'll keep plugging away at this but would like some objective
ideas or places to check.
